Ive had two big fish rooms before in my garage, one with thirty tanks and the other with nine. We used to breed rare and oddball American cichlids. Was good fun, but these days I'm happy with just the one, although I'm considering keeping my current tank when I get my 8ft. This is where the garage starts to turn into a fish room again lol.

I'm jealous of all of you in the US. There isn't really a fish 'scene' round here. The nearest club is a few hours drive away, even the lfs' have dwindled over the years.

vincentwugwg vincentwugwg +1. I also recommend sealing and heating the garage. We had a fan heater, a fake ceiling with loft insulation, double glazing, external wall paint to seal the bricks, a double layer of thick underlay and a cheap carpet, and we didn't even need heaters in the tanks. Was boiling in there, even in the winter.
